    Since you found the place, you just need a lawyer. I think the agent is more for searching, advertising, arranging for viewings etc...

    The lawyer does the rest. The lawyer can do due diligence as well. But if the same lawyer represent both you and your sister, there might be some conflict of interest, just in case something turns bad, who will he side?

    If your sister is best pals with you, just use one lawyer. Otherwise, get one lawyer each, which may be the case as some banks (assuming you take a mortgage loan) due with only some lawyers form their panel. In any case, no need to involve the agent here.
